Set legacy security settingsedit
This endpoint is deprecated and scheduled to be removed in the next major version.
Sets the legacy Shield security settings for a 2.x Elasticsearch cluster.
Requestedit
PUT /api/v1/clusters/elasticsearch/{cluster_id}/settings/security/legacy

Request exampleedit
curl -XPUT https://{{hostname}}/api/v1/clusters/elasticsearch/{cluster_id}/settings/security/legacy \ -H "Authorization: ApiKey $ECE_API_KEY" \ -H 'Content-Type: application/json' \ -d ' { "roles_yaml" : "string", "users_roles_yaml" : "string", "users_yaml" : "string" } '
